Responsibilities

  • Lead a team responsible for digital ASIC verification at block and system level.
  • Lead and execute verification test plan, development, and milestones from beginning to end, develop test harnesses and test sequences.
  • Develop SystemVerilog testbench infrastructure (both UVM and non-UVM) for testing designs, including DSP blocks.
  • Responsible for overseeing test plan execution, running regressions, code and functional coverage closure.
  • Contribute to pre-silicon verification, chip bring-up and post-silicon validation.
  • Work with leaders across the engineering organization to drive product requirements to push the performance envelope for Starshield satellites.
  • Recruit, develop, train, and retain world class team members who will deliver for our Nation and amplify the team.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in electrical engineering, computer engineering, computer science, or another engineering discipline.
  • 4+ years of experience with design verification and test bench development.

LEAD ASIC DESIGN VERIFICATION ENGINEER (STARSHIELD) Starshield leverages SpaceX's Starlink technology and launch capability to support national security efforts. While Starlink is designed for consumer and commercial use, Starshield is designed for government use, with an initial focus on earth observation, communications, and hosted payloads. The Lead ASIC Design Verification Engineer will lead a team that supports custom ASICs and FPGAs design for cutting edge satellites systems that deliver unprecedented quantities of data at unheard of speeds to the service-members who defend our Nation and Allies. From initial design through on-orbit operations this person is responsible for leading a phenomenal team of engineers in a collaborative effort to design, manufacture, test and operate chips for satellites that make our Nation safer.
